Carbon monoxide alarm triggers response at residenceNew Orleans LA

Heads up: This post was detected from real-time dispatch audio. Information may be incomplete, and the situation may evolve. Always verify using official agency releases.

audio iconFire & Arson
Eastover Dr, New Orleans, LA 70128

A carbon monoxide alarm was reported at a residence near Eastover Drive, Oakmont Drive, and Lake Forest Boulevard. Fire units responded and were cleared to leave except Engine 36, which remained on scene.
